Temperature sensitive secretion of mutant myocilins.
Experimental eye research - 1 Jun 2006
Vollrath Douglas, Liu Yuhui
Abstract excerpt
Recent studies have demonstrated that glaucoma-causing mutant myocilin proteins are misfolded and retained in the endoplasmic reticulum of cells. We showed previously that P370L mutant myocilin is poorly secreted at 37 degrees C and prolonged expression of the protein in differentiated human trabecular meshwork cells results in abnormal morphology and cell killing.
